Cyclosporiasis Surges in Texas | Texas News

Cyclosporiasis is surging in Texas, with 48 cases reported as of July 9 amid over 1,000 nationwide — a familiar pattern since 2018, when the state averaged nearly 600 cases yearly. Caused by a microscopic parasite from contaminated food or water, it triggers explosive diarrhea, fatigue, weight loss, and cramps, with symptoms appearing two weeks after exposure. While outbreaks often trace back to imported produce like cilantro or raspberries, the parasite doesn’t spread person-to-person. Stay vigilant with fresh foods — if you’re feeling sick, see a doctor.
